ETS Reunion
Evangelical Theological Seminary (ETS) alums of the 50's, 60's, 70's gathered at North Central College in Naperville, Illinois for an ETS reunion. The theme of the three-day event was, "Living the Theology We Affirm." Current administration and faculty of Garrett-Evangelical offered greetings as well as a session on the future of theological education. Rev. Dr. Rita Nakashima Brock
Rev. Dr. Rita Nakashima Brock gave a sermon entitled, "Requiem" reflecting on the recent tragic events in Japan. Dr. Brock was also the keynote lecturer for the Asian Theology Conference, a part of Asian Week at Garrett-Evangelical.

Dr. Eric Gregory of Princeton University
Dr. Eric Gregory, Professor of Religion at Princeton University, gave a guest lecture at Garrett-Evangelical called, "Love, Sin, and Civic Virtues: Reviving a Political Augustinianism."
